**Mgmt Meeting Minutes — Retiring the Brightline Range**

Quick recap for sales leads at Fenholt Supplies: we agreed to retire the Brightline fixture range by year-end. Remaining stock moves to clearance pricing next month, and accounts on standing orders get migrated to the Lumetta range. Trade-in incentives were approved in principle. The confidential note on next steps sits just below.

board note of bajof-bajeg: The pricing group signed off on a budget of $13.4 million for Project Sildor. The renewal with Lamixek Holdings closes at $48.9 million a year, 49 percent above the last contract.

**Alert: Payroll Export Format Change — Meridale Payroll Suite**

The upcoming 4.2 release changes the Meridale payroll export from fixed-width to delimited records. Downstream consumers, including the Brackenhall reconciliation job, must update their parsers before the release window. The old format will be emitted in parallel for one pay cycle only. Please confirm all consumers have acknowledged the change before approving the cutover. Unconfirmed consumers should be escalated to the payroll integrations team.

escalation mailbox, bafog-fafog: ulador@paliqlabs.internal

- [ ] Step 7: Archive cold storage buckets (Glacierline tier). Confirm both ceremony witnesses are present, verify bucket manifests match the Oxbow ledger, then seal the archive key shares. Plugin authors may observe but not handle shares. Once sealed, the archive index itself is encrypted and can only be reopened with the passphrase below.

vault phrase of badup-hahig = tamael-aldael-kelmir-istael-fenok-istwyn-tamius-jorath-oliion